22 lines
477 B
Desktop File
Executable File
22 lines
477 B
Desktop File
Executable File
[Unit]
|
|
Description=Secure storage init (fscrypt)
|
|
After=local-fs.target
|
|
Before=multi-user.target
|
|
Before=shutdown.target
|
|
Conflicts=shutdown.target
|
|
|
|
[Service]
|
|
Type=oneshot
|
|
RuntimeDirectory=secure-storage
|
|
RuntimeDirectoryMode=0700
|
|
EnvironmentFile=/etc/default/secure-storage
|
|
ExecStart=/usr/sbin/secure-storage-init.sh start
|
|
ExecStop=/usr/sbin/secure-storage-init.sh stop
|
|
RemainAfterExit=yes
|
|
|
|
# Make shutdown not wait forever
|
|
TimeoutStopSec=2s
|
|
|
|
[Install]
|
|
WantedBy=multi-user.target
|